NASA-PDS / planetary-data-engine

Free-text search capability for planetary data, services, tools, and information
Apache License 2.0
0 stars 0 forks source link

Register PDS context products in Sinequa PDS sandbox #24

Open jjacob7734 opened 6 months ago

jjacob7734 commented 6 months ago

💡 Description

Extend the Sinequa PDS sandbox search deployment to include the PDS context products described at https://github.com/NASA-PDS/nasa-pds.github.io/wiki/Searching-for-PDS-Data-with-Legacy-Registry.

⚔️ Parent Epic / Related Tickets

No response

jjacob7734 commented 6 months ago

This API endpoint returns all context products, which might be more than we want: https://pds.nasa.gov/services/search/search?wt=json&q=objectType:Product_Context

jordanpadams commented 5 months ago

status: Adding this to the wiki documentation.

tloubrieu-jpl commented 5 months ago

Something does not work with this new index. @jjacob7734 will remove all the indices and re-create them to fix that.

tloubrieu-jpl commented 5 months ago

The indices are recreated and contect product now show, but @jjacob7734 needs to understand how the results are categories because currently the context products show as data.

It might require to create a specific source for the context products.

tloubrieu-jpl commented 5 months ago

@jjacob7734 changed the source mapping so that the context products show in their own tab, and in their own category in the tree on the left.

It requires to re-ingest all the products so that they show as expected with new configuration.

tloubrieu-jpl commented 5 months ago

This does not work yet. @jjacob7734 will ask for support at the Sinequa people.

tloubrieu-jpl commented 5 months ago

The issue was related to the mapping of our API outputs with Sinequa. It is now fixed. Re-indexation needs to be done.

There is a remaining issue with the HTML template for the preview of the document.

nutjob4life commented 4 months ago

@jjacob7734 troubleshooting issues with Sinequa on the SDE (?) team; getting "connector errors" when trying to register context products. Ashish has also been trying some runs. Met in person last week and did get documents in the index! Jordan CC'd on email to Ashish.

jordanpadams commented 4 months ago

Moving back to icebox since this was not completed